Cockatoo island
This island is the biggest in the harbour and has a mixed history of being a prison, a shipyard and a place of industry.
A windy ferry crossing over but a lovely sunny day for exploring with the audio guide and kids trail.
During ww2 after Singapore was captured by the Japanese, this is where allied ships came to be fixed up as it was the only place in the south pacific able to do so.
